Seoul Weather Overview
Seoul experiences four distinct seasons:
Spring (March-May):Mild temperatures, cherry blossoms, and blooming flowers.
Summer (June-August):Hot and humid with monsoon season in July.
Autumn (September-November):Cool and dry with stunning fall foliage.
Winter (December-February):Cold and dry with occasional snowfall.
Month-by-Month Guide to Visiting Seoul
January: Winter Wonderland
January is the coldest month in Seoul, with average temperatures ranging from -6°C to 1°C (21°F to 34°F). Expect snow and icy conditions.
Pros:Fewer tourists, opportunities for winter sports like skiing and snowboarding nearby.
Cons:Cold weather may limit outdoor activities.
Events:Winter festivals and ice skating rinks.
February: Continuing Winter
February is similar to January in terms of weather, with slightly longer daylight hours.
Pros:Still fewer tourists than peak seasons.
Cons:Cold weather persists.
Events:Lunar New Year (Seollal) celebrations.
March: Spring Begins
March sees the beginning of spring, with temperatures gradually rising. Average temperatures range from 2°C to 10°C (36°F to 50°F).
Pros:Cherry blossoms start to bloom towards the end of the month.
Cons:Still can be chilly, especially in the evenings.
Events:Early cherry blossom festivals.
April: Cherry Blossom Season
April is one of the best times to visit Seoul. The city is covered in cherry blossoms, and the weather is mild and pleasant. Average temperatures range from 8°C to 18°C (46°F to 64°F).
Pros:Beautiful scenery, numerous outdoor activities.
Cons:Higher tourist crowds, higher prices.
Events:Cherry blossom festivals throughout the city.
May: Perfect Spring Weather
May offers ideal spring weather with comfortable temperatures and sunny days. Average temperatures range from 14°C to 24°C (57°F to 75°F).
Pros:Pleasant weather, fewer crowds than April.
Cons:Occasional rain showers.
Events:Seoul Jazz Festival, Lotus Lantern Festival.
June: Early Summer
June marks the beginning of summer in Seoul. Temperatures start to rise, and humidity increases. Average temperatures range from 19°C to 28°C (66°F to 82°F).
Pros:Lush greenery, fewer tourists than peak summer months.
Cons:Increasing humidity.
Events:Dano Festival.
July: Monsoon Season
July is the peak of monsoon season in Seoul. Expect heavy rainfall and high humidity. Average temperatures range from 22°C to 30°C (72°F to 86°F).
Pros:Fewer tourists, lower prices.
Cons:Heavy rain may disrupt travel plans.
Events:Boryeong Mud Festival (nearby).
August: Hot and Humid
August is hot and humid, with temperatures similar to July. Rainfall decreases towards the end of the month. Average temperatures range from 23°C to 31°C (73°F to 88°F).
Pros:Vibrant nightlife, water parks.
Cons:Uncomfortable heat and humidity.
Events:Various music festivals.
September: Autumn Arrives
September brings the start of autumn, with cooler temperatures and clear skies. Average temperatures range from 18°C to 26°C (64°F to 79°F).
Pros:Pleasant weather, beautiful autumn foliage.
Cons:Increasing tourist crowds.
Events:Chuseok (Korean Thanksgiving).
October: Peak Autumn Foliage
October is another excellent time to visit Seoul. The city is ablaze with autumn colors, and the weather is mild and dry. Average temperatures range from 11°C to 19°C (52°F to 66°F).
Pros:Stunning scenery, numerous outdoor activities.
Cons:Higher tourist crowds, higher prices.
Events:Seoul International Fireworks Festival.
Caption: Namsan Park offers breathtaking views of Seoul bathed in autumn colors.
November: Late Autumn
November marks the end of autumn, with temperatures gradually decreasing. Average temperatures range from 4°C to 12°C (39°F to 54°F).
Pros:Fewer tourists than October, still some autumn foliage.
Cons:Chilly weather.
Events:Seoul Lantern Festival.
December: Winter Begins
December is the start of winter in Seoul, with cold temperatures and occasional snowfall. Average temperatures range from -4°C to 4°C (25°F to 39°F).
Pros:Festive atmosphere, Christmas markets.
Cons:Cold weather, shorter daylight hours.
Events:Christmas celebrations, New Year's Eve events.

Conclusion: Planning Your Seoul Adventure
The best time to visit Seoul depends on your preferences. Spring (April-May) and autumn (September-October) offer the most pleasant weather and stunning scenery, but expect larger crowds. Summer (June-August) can be hot and humid, while winter (December-February) is cold but offers unique winter experiences.
